Mary was born on 25 Sep 1916 in Clarksville, Arkansas. She was the daughter of Felix Stegall and Nora King.[1][2]
Mary passed away in Washington County, Arkansas on 5 Feb 2004 and was buried in the Pinecrest Memorial Park and Garden Mausoleum, Alexander, Arkansas.[3][4]
